Luotian, a county nestled in the eastern part of Hubei province, China, is a hidden gem for outdoor enthusiasts, particularly those who appreciate challenging yet rewarding hikes. While not as internationally renowned as some other hiking destinations, Luotian boasts a diverse landscape brimming with stunning scenery, ranging from lush forests and cascading waterfalls to rugged peaks and serene valleys. One of the highlights of my Luotian hiking experience was exploring the Dayang Lake National Forest Park (大洋湖国家森林公园). This park is a haven for biodiversity, boasting a remarkable variety of flora and fauna. The trails wind through towering ancient trees, creating a sense of immersion in nature that’s truly breathtaking. The air is crisp and clean, scented with the earthy aroma of pine and damp soil. I spent a full day exploring different trails within the park, each offering a unique perspective on the landscape. Some trails lead to breathtaking viewpoints overlooking the lake, while others wind through dense forests, offering glimpses of wildlife. I even spotted a family of monkeys playfully swinging through the branches!
The trails within Dayang Lake National Forest Park are generally well-marked, although having a map or GPS device is always recommended. The signage is primarily in Chinese, so downloading a translation app beforehand is helpful. The difficulty levels vary, allowing hikers to choose trails that match their fitness levels and experience. There are shorter loops perfect for a half-day hike, as well as longer, more challenging routes that can easily fill a whole day.

For a more challenging hike, I recommend exploring the Luotian's less-developed mountain ranges. These areas are less frequented by tourists, offering a more secluded and wild hiking experience. However, it’s crucial to be well-prepared for these adventures. Ensure you have sufficient water, food, appropriate clothing and footwear, a first-aid kit, and a detailed map or GPS device. It’s also wise to inform someone of your hiking plans and expected return time. The lack of readily available facilities in these remote areas necessitates meticulous planning.

The best time to hike in Luotian is during spring and autumn. The weather is pleasant, with moderate temperatures and clear skies. Summer can be hot and humid, while winter can bring freezing temperatures and potential snow or ice on the higher trails. Always check the weather forecast before embarking on your hike and adjust your plans accordingly.
